Claims
- 1. A method of making a double row roller bearing retainer from flat metal stock comprising the steps of:
- making a plurality of pockets in a flat metal strip to provide pockets in the flat metal strip separated by cross-bars, and at the same time making scallops on each edge of the flat metal strip; shaping the cross-bars for roller guidance and for roller retention; U-forming the flat metal strip to provide a strip having a U-shaped cross-section; cutting off a predetermined length of the U-formed strip to provide a U-formed strip having two ends; wrapping the predetermined length into an annular retainer; and bonding the two ends together.
- 2. The method of claim 1 wherein: an axially centered band is wrapped around the retainer and bonded to the cross-bars.
- 3. The method of claim 1 wherein: the dimensions of the pockets made are such that a transversely centered integral bar is formed.
